  • 25.06.13

    La CittàLago

    Forum Omegna, 13 June 2025 

    Status: Past Event 

    On 13 June 2025, the Forum Omegna hosted the opening of the exhibition “La CittàLago”, an initiative developed within the research activities promoted by the Department of Architecture and Urban Studies of Politecnico di Milano. The exhibition presents an extended reflection on the Orta Lake region as a significant case for investigating sustainability challenges and socio-ecological transitions in Italy’s intermediate territories. 

    The materials on display originate from the urban planning studios conducted in the academic years 2023–24 and 2024–25, which explored the Cusio area as a privileged observatory for research-by-design. The exhibition highlights the coexistence of multiple spatial, environmental, and socio-economic conditions: varying degrees of reliance on lake-related resources, renewed and historical manufacturing presences, emerging forms of extended living, and growing pressures linked to tourism development. These elements collectively contribute to defining what has been tentatively described as a “lake-city” condition. Organised into four thematic sections—a city with the lake at its centre; the district within the landscape; between waters and forests; extended and multilocal dwelling—the exhibition provides an integrated interpretation of ongoing transformations. 

    During the inauguration, the students engaged in a public discussion with invited guests, including Francesco Rizzi (USI – Università della Svizzera italiana), the Ecomuseo Cusius, Fondazione P.Ar.C.O., local administrations and key regional stakeholders. 

  • 25.10.1–3

    DUT PED Conference

    Fondazione Catella, Milan, 1–3 October 2025 

    Status: Past Event 

    The InterPED research team participated in the DUT PED Conference, held in Milan from 1 to 3 October 2025, an international event dedicated to Positive Energy Districts and urban energy transitions. The conference brought together researchers, practitioners, and institutional actors engaged in developing PED strategies across Europe. 

    InterPED contributed to the programme with a poster presentation illustrating the project’s objectives, methodological framework, and early activities. The contribution focused on the relevance of intermediate territories in the European energy transition, outlining the project’s co-productive approach and its planned cross-country comparative structure. Participation in the conference provided an important opportunity to situate InterPED within the wider DUT community, strengthen exchanges with other PED-related initiatives, and consolidate the project’s dissemination and networking actions.
